O22.5 — Cerebral venous thrombosis in pregnancy
O22.5 is a non-billable header ICD-10-CM code for cerebral venous thrombosis in pregnancy. It cannot be billed on its own: choose one of the more specific child codes below.

Other codes that can never be billed with O22.5
These codes carry an Excludes1 note pointing at O22.5. The conflict binds both ways, but ICD-10-CM only writes it down on one side — so you would not find this by reading O22.5 alone.
- G08Intracranial and intraspinal phlebitis and thrombophlebitis
Risk adjustment
O22.5 does not map to an HCC and does not risk-adjust under CMS-HCC V28. That is normal — most ICD-10 codes do not. It still needs to be coded correctly; it just will not move a RAF score.

Questions about O22.5
- Is O22.5 a billable ICD-10-CM code?
- No. O22.5 is a non-billable header code. Code to a higher level of specificity using one of its child codes.
- Where does O22.5 sit in the tabular list?
- Pregnancy, childbirth and the puerperium (O00-O9A), in the block Other maternal disorders predominantly related to pregnancy (O20-O29).
